advertising revenue

Musk says Twitter has lost half its advertising revenue

NEW YORK: Twitter has lost roughly half of its advertising revenue, according to owner Elon… Read More

Musk says Twitter has lost half its advertising revenue

Twitter owner Elon Musk said Saturday that the social media platform he bought for $44… Read More